Zoe Moonshine, originally from South Africa, has made her mark in the realm of cult cinema with her performances in Flesh for Olivia (2002) and Satan's School for Lust (2002). Her work in these films showcases a bold approach to the erotic thriller genre, blending elements of exploitation with dark humor. Meeting and marrying filmmaker William Hellfire in the UK further anchored her in the underground film scene, where she continues to embody the provocative spirit that defines the films she appears in.
